Addressing Common Issues in Hunter I20 Sprinklers
Hunter I20 sprinklers are known for their reliability, but even the best systems can encounter problems. Fortunately, many common issues are easily diagnosed and repairedd at home. To get started, begin by checking your system for any visible damage or issues. Check the sprinkler heads for clogs or debris, and ensure that the control valve is working properly. A regular problem is a faulty solenoid valve, which regulates the flow of water to each zone. If you believe this might be the issue, replace the valve with a new one.
- Additionally, it's important to check the wiring and connections for any loose or corroded components.
- Remember to consider the possibility of a problem with your water supply, such as low pressure or a leaky main line.
However get more info you're unable to troubleshoot the issue on your own, it's best to contact a qualified irrigation professional for assistance.
